A veterinary practice in Bristol is seeking a passionate Registered Veterinary Nurse for a part-time position, offering 24-30 hours per week and a supportive team environment. The role includes responsibilities such as providing veterinary nursing care and participating in a Saturday morning rota. Candidates should have a Registered Veterinary Nurse qualification.

The practice invests in professional development, offering CPD allowances and a variety of employee benefits including private medical insurance and flexible holiday policies.
